Content Services的JSON導出器

Content Services旨在AEM將內容的描述和交付範圍擴展到網頁AEM的焦點之外。

它們使用可供任何客戶使用的標準化方法,將內AEM容交付到非傳統網頁的渠道。 這些渠道可包括:

  • 單頁應用程式
  • 本機移動應用程式
  • 外部的其他通道和觸AEM點

使用使用結構化內容的內容片段,您可以通過使用JSON導出器以JSON資料模型格式傳遞(y)頁AEM的內容來提供內容服務。 這樣,您自己的應用程式就可以使用它。

包含內容片段核心元件的JSON導出器

使用AEMJSON導出器,您可以以JSON資料模型格式AEM傳遞(y)頁的內容。 這樣,您自己的應用程式就可以使用它。

在交AEM貨中使用選擇器實現 model.json 擴展。

.model.json

  1. 例如,URL,如:

    http://localhost:4502/content/wknd/language-masters/en/magazine/guide-la-skateparks.model.json
    
  2. 將提供內容,如:

    WKND內容的JSON模型

或者,可以通過將結構化內容片段的內容指定為特定目標來傳遞該內容。

這是使用片段的整個路徑(通過 jcr:content);例如,帶有尾碼,如。

.../jcr:content/root/container/container/contentfragment.model.json

您的頁面可以包含單個內容片段或多種類型的多個元件。 也可以使用清單元件等機制自動搜索相關內容。

  • 例如,URL,如:

    http://localhost:4502/content/wknd/language-masters/en/magazine/guide-la-skateparks/jcr:content/root/container/container/contentfragment.model.json
    
  • 將提供內容,如:

    WKND內容片段的JSON模型

    注意

    你可以 調整自己的元件 訪問和使用此資料。

    注意

    雖然不是標準實施, 支援多個選擇器,model 肯定是第一個。

更多資訊

另請參閱:

有關詳細資訊,請參閱:

本頁內容